Van: Simple Multi-Process Execution

Code Climate

Van is meant to provide simple multi-process execution for Node scripts.

Warning: This library was created and intended for spinning up multiple processes on a local development environment. It isn't designed or intended (at least at this point) for any kind of production-server like usage. In other words, this is a dev utility not a foreman replacement.

Installation

npm install --save van

Interleave

The most common use case for Van is to run several processes at once and interleave their output. Van also makes it easy to send termination signals to all of the child processes at once as well as know when all child processes have exited. An example:

var Van = require("van")
 
var van = new Van({
  scripts: {
    jekyll: 'bundle exec jekyll build --watch', 
    server: 'superstatic -p 4000'
  }
});
 
// spawn the child processes and interleave output
van.start();
 
process.on('SIGINT', function() {
  // send a kill signal to each child process
  van.stop();
});

Sequence

You may also wish to run a series of scripts in sequence, stopping execution if any of them exit with a non-zero code. Van makes this easy, too!

var van = new Van({
  scripts: [
    "my/first/script",
    "my/second/script"
  ]
});
 
van.run();

By calling run() instead of start() you are signaling that you wish to execute the scripts sequentially.

Custom Configuration

You may need more sophisticated configuration than the scripts option provides. For these cases, you can manually add new passengers to the van with some additional configuration options:

var van = new Van();
 
van.addPassenger('path/to/script', {cwd: '/working/dir'});
 
van.start(); // or .run();

The available options are:

  • cwd: pass in a working directory you'd like the script to run in
  • prefix: when running in interleave mode, this will be the [prefix]
  • color: choose a console color for the prefix. Can be any color supported by colors
